图书管理系统工程管理:如何高效推进项目落地与持续优化
在数字化转型浪潮中,图书管理系统作为图书馆现代化运营的核心基础设施,其工程管理水平直接决定了服务效率、用户体验和资源利用率。一个成功的图书管理系统工程不仅需要技术实现的完整性,更依赖于科学的项目管理方法论,涵盖需求分析、系统设计、开发实施、测试验证、上线部署、运维支持及迭代升级等多个阶段。本文将从工程管理的全流程出发,深入探讨图书管理系统建设中的关键环节与实践策略,帮助管理者构建可持续、可扩展且用户友好的智慧图书馆体系。
一、明确目标与范围:项目启动阶段的基石
任何工程项目的第一步都是清晰定义目标和边界。对于图书管理系统而言,需首先厘清业务痛点:是传统手工借还书效率低下?还是馆藏资源分散难以统一管理?或是缺乏数据分析能力无法支撑决策?通过调研、访谈和问卷等方式收集多方需求后,应形成一份详尽的需求规格说明书(SRS),明确功能模块(如读者管理、图书编目、流通控制、预约查询、统计报表等)和非功能性要求(性能、安全性、兼容性、易用性等)。
同时,必须划定项目范围,避免“无限扩展”陷阱。例如,初期可聚焦核心功能——图书采编、借阅管理、库存盘点;后续再逐步加入数字资源集成、移动应用、智能推荐等功能。这有助于控制预算、时间成本,并确保阶段性成果可交付、可评估。
二、组建专业团队:跨职能协作是成功的关键
图书管理系统工程涉及多个角色协同工作,包括项目经理、业务分析师、系统架构师、开发工程师、测试人员、UI/UX设计师以及图书馆一线工作人员。建议采用敏捷开发模式(如Scrum),设立每日站会、迭代评审和回顾机制,促进沟通透明化。
特别要注意的是,图书馆员不仅是最终用户,更是需求的重要来源。应邀请他们参与原型设计和测试过程,确保系统贴合实际操作流程,减少后期返工。此外,IT部门与图书馆管理部门之间需建立定期协调机制,保障项目进度与组织战略一致。
三、制定详细计划:时间线与风险管理并重
使用甘特图或P6软件制定详细的项目计划,将整个生命周期划分为若干里程碑节点(如需求冻结、原型确认、开发完成、UAT测试、上线部署)。每个阶段设置明确的质量标准和验收条件。
风险识别同样不可忽视。常见风险包括:数据迁移失败、第三方接口不稳定、用户抵触情绪、预算超支等。应提前制定应急预案,比如预留20%缓冲时间应对延期,备份历史数据防止丢失,开展培训提升用户接受度。
四、系统设计与开发:技术选型决定未来可维护性
技术架构的选择直接影响系统的稳定性与扩展性。主流方案包括:基于Web的B/S架构(如Java Spring Boot + Vue.js)、微服务架构、云原生部署(AWS/Azure/GCP)。若图书馆已有OA或ERP系统,应优先考虑API对接而非重复开发。
数据库设计需遵循规范化原则,合理划分表结构,避免冗余字段;同时兼顾读写分离、缓存机制(Redis)以提升响应速度。前端界面应注重无障碍访问(WCAG标准),适配不同终端设备(PC、平板、手机)。
五、测试验证:质量保证贯穿始终
测试不应仅在开发完成后进行,而应在每个迭代周期内嵌入单元测试、集成测试和用户验收测试(UAT)。重点检查以下维度:
- 功能正确性:是否符合原始需求?是否存在逻辑漏洞?
- 性能指标:并发访问下响应时间是否达标(如≤3秒)?
- 安全性:是否有SQL注入、XSS攻击防护?权限控制是否严谨?
- 兼容性:能否在Chrome、Edge、Firefox等主流浏览器正常运行?
- 数据一致性:借阅记录、库存状态是否实时同步?
建议引入自动化测试工具(如Selenium、Postman),提高测试覆盖率和效率。对于复杂场景(如多馆联动、跨平台同步),可搭建沙箱环境模拟真实业务流。
六、上线部署与培训:平稳过渡才能赢得信任
上线前需做好充分准备:备份旧系统数据、制定回滚方案、配置服务器环境、通知全体用户。可采用分批上线策略,先在小范围试点(如某个阅览室或科室),收集反馈后再全面推广。
培训是成败关键之一。不仅要讲解系统操作流程,更要说明变革的意义和优势,激发员工主动性。可制作图文手册、短视频教程,并设置答疑群组,提供即时技术支持。
七、运维监控与持续优化:让系统“活”起来
上线不是终点,而是新起点。应建立完善的运维体系,包括日志监控(ELK Stack)、故障告警(Prometheus+Grafana)、定期巡检(每月一次健康检查)等。通过用户行为分析(如热力图、点击路径)发现使用痛点,不断优化交互体验。
更重要的是,要建立持续改进机制。每季度召开一次“系统优化会议”,由用户代表、技术人员、管理人员共同讨论改进建议。例如增加语音搜索、引入AI辅助编目、接入国家图书馆资源平台等,使系统始终保持活力与竞争力。
八、案例参考:某高校图书馆的成功实践
以华东某大学图书馆为例,该项目历时9个月完成,总投资约80万元。初期投入大量精力做需求调研,最终确定了包含5大模块、20项子功能的系统框架。采用敏捷开发方式,每两周发布一个版本,共完成4次迭代。上线后读者满意度从68%提升至92%,平均借阅处理时间由15分钟缩短至3分钟。目前该系统已稳定运行两年,每年根据师生反馈新增2-3个实用功能。
此案例表明,良好的工程管理不仅能如期交付高质量系统,更能带来显著的服务价值提升。
结语:图书管理系统工程管理是一项长期投资
图书管理系统并非一次性建设任务,而是伴随图书馆发展不断演进的过程。唯有坚持科学的工程管理理念——从规划到执行再到优化闭环,才能真正实现“以用户为中心”的智慧服务目标。未来的图书管理系统将更加智能化、个性化、开放化,而这一切的基础,正是扎实的工程管理能力。





